Research

My area of academic pursuit is the treatment of hematologic malignancies and hematopoietic stem cell transplantation. I serve on the Core Transplant, Myeloma and Leukemia Committees of the CALGB, the Myeloma Committee of the BMT Clinical Trials Network (CTN) and the Multiple Myeloma Cancer Immunotherapy Guideline Panel of the Society for Immunotherapy of Cancer. I have served on the American Society of Clinical Oncology and the American Society of Hematology Scientific Committees on Plasma Cell Dyscrasias. I have served as principal investigator on several national and institutional clinical trials looking at strategies to improve the outcome of patients with multiple myeloma, acute myeloid leukemia and myelodysplastic syndromes and played a role in the development of drugs approved for Multiple Myeloma and oversee an active clinical research program in multiple myeloma. As Principal Investigator for the Multiple Myeloma Tissue Banking Initiative, I work closely with basic scientists both within and outside the institution to study the genomics and biology of the disease and harness the knowledge to foster better therapeutic options including a number of personalized medicine and immunotherapy initiatives for treatment of multiple myeloma including studies with CAR-T cells and T cell engagers.
